Quero criar um banco de dados de séries de TV usando o WordPress. Segui alguns tutoriais e tenho dois tipos de postagem personalizados: um para movies
, um para e series
. Eu segui este post para a estrutura .
Minha pergunta é: como posso fazer a relação entre os filmes e os tipos de postagem das séries?
custom-post-types
CoalaArmy
fonte
fonte
"implement the post_type as directed"
o que você quer dizer?Respostas:
Usando um plug-in
Alguns plugins muito bons para relacionamentos:
Usando uma Metabox
Você pode criar um relacionamento simples usando metaboxes:
E então, para obter o relacionamento dos filmes como uma lista de postagens em séries:
fonte
http://domain.com/series-name/movie-name
:?Eu recomendo o plug-in Posts 2 Posts , que eu comecei a usar.
Ele permite que você crie muitos-para-muitos relações entre os postes e tipos de página, o que significa que você pode ligar
movies
aseries
, e quaisquer outros CPTs você pode criar.Este plug-in também permite criar metadados de conexão, o que permitirá obter mais detalhes ao criar suas conexões. É bastante flexível em seu uso, permitindo o controle sobre metaboxes administrativos, tipos de conexão e maneiras de exibir suas conexões no front-end. Por fim, está bem documentado .
fonte
Infelizmente, o plug-in Postagens 2 Postagens foi descontinuado e não é mais mantido. Há um novo plugin alternativo para os Relacionamentos em MB . É inspirado no P2P e fornece uma API semelhante para criar relacionamentos entre postagens, termos e usuários.
O MB Relationships suporta relacionamentos bidirecionais por padrão e usa uma tabela personalizada para armazenar relacionamentos (como P2P) para um melhor desempenho (do que pós meta).
Vale a pena dar uma olhada no plugin.
fonte